Advanced Operations

Sleep Timer Setting

Press SLEEP one or more times to select
delay time between 15 and 60 minutes,
after the unit will turn off.
To cancel the sleep function, press SLEEP
repeatedly until "SLEEP 15" appears, and
then press SLEEP once again while "SLEEP
15" is displayed.
NOTE
Depending on the SLEEP timer setting, there
may be a few minutes of discrepancy.

Dimmer

Press DIMMER once. The display changes
among three levels of brightness. To cancel
it, press DIMMER repeatedly until dim off.

Screen Saver

The screen saver appears when you
leave the unit in Stop mode for about five
minutes.

Turn off the sound temporarily

Press MUTE to mute your unit.
You can mute your unit, for example,
to answer the telephone, the "MUTE"
displayed in the display window.

Audio Sync

Sometimes Digital TV encounters a delay
between picture and sound. You can
improve it by setting the delay on the
sound.

Listening to music from your
portable player or external
device
The unit can be used to play the music
from many types of portable player or
external devices. (Refer to the page 22)
1. Connect the portable player to the
PORTABLE IN connector of the unit.
Connect the external device to the AUX
connector of the unit.
2. Turn the power on by pressing
STANDBY/ON .
3. Select PORTABLE or AUX function by
pressing FUNCTION , AUX , or PORTABLE
IN button.
4. Turn the portable player or external
device and start it playing.
